7 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Dyad'
The professor emphasized the importance of the teacher-student dyad in education.
The literary dyad of author and editor collaborated on a best-selling novel.
The dyad of love and trust forms the foundation of a healthy relationship.
The political dyad of power and responsibility shapes the dynamics of governance.
In mathematics, a dyad refers to a set of two elements considered as a single entity.
The dyad of tradition and modernity is a central theme in this cultural analysis.
The dyad of supply and demand influences market equilibrium in economics.
